* defs.h: Add new struct tcb fields: wait_status, next_need_service.
make flags field wider (ints are easier to work with on many CPUs).
* strace.c (trace): Split this function into two:
collect_stopped_tcbs() and handle_stopped_tcbs().
Now we collect *all* waitable tasks, then handle them all,
then repeat.
Fixes RH#478419 "Some threads stop when strace with -f option
is executed on a multi-thread process"
* test/many_looping_threads.c: example program which cna't be straced
successfully without this fix.

+static int
+trace()
+{
+ int rc;
+ struct tcb *tcbs;
+
+ while (nprocs != 0) {
+ if (interrupted)
+ return 0;
+ if (interactive)
+ sigprocmask(SIG_SETMASK, &empty_set, NULL);
+
+ /* The loop of "wait for one tracee, serve it, repeat"
+ * may leave some tracees never served.
+ * Kernel provides no guarantees of fairness when you have
+ * many waitable tasks.
+ * Try strace -f with test/many_looping_threads.c example.
+ * To fix it, we collect *all* waitable tasks, then handle
+ * them all, then repeat.
+ */
+ tcbs = collect_stopped_tcbs();
+ if (!tcbs)
+ break;
+ rc = handle_stopped_tcbs(tcbs);
+ if (rc)
+ return rc;
}
return 0;
}
